Simple Recipes for Homemade Furniture Cleaners

Here are some simple recipes you can try at home:

1. Basic Wood Cleaner

Mix one cup of water, half a cup of vinegar, and two tablespoons of olive oil. Add a few drops of essential oil for fragrance. Shake well before use and apply with a soft cloth.

2. Citrus Fresh Cleaner

Combine one cup of vinegar with half a cup of lemon juice. This mixture is perfect for cutting through grease and leaving a fresh scent.

3. Baking Soda Paste

For tough stains, mix baking soda with a little water to form a paste. Apply to the stain, let it sit for a few minutes, then wipe clean.
